My Journey at IIIT Delhi: A tale of growth and Discovery

Dislikes

  • The college size is not so big it is just 25acres in area.

Course Curriculum Overview :

The courses are great. We can choose courses in any field. After our 4th semester, we are open to all the courses. The forces helped to build my overall confidence and boost me. The curriculum is updated from time to time as time changes. There are several quizzes happen in the middle of the semester the frequency depends of the professor he can take up to 10 or just two including midsems and endsems, the paper difficulty is good enough to fail you if you don;t study in other words its difficult.

Internships Opportunities :

The internships are provided by the college to faculties and companies, and the stipend varies between 20000-100000 rupees. The roles of the internship are Software developer intern, research undergrad etc.

Placement Experience :

From the 7th semester the student is available for college placements as the companies started to visit the college, and the student has to maintain a minimum of 6 CGPA for seating in the college placements. The companies include Google, Microsoft, Adobe, Oracle, Meta, Cognizant, JP Morgan, and many more top companies. The highest Package of all time is 1.83 crores per annum, and this year, the highest placement is 47lpa with an average of 21.75lpa. This year, the placement percentage is about 85%; my plans after getting the degree are to work for about 2-3 years and then prepare for Civil Services.

Loan/ Scholarship Provisions :

The tuition fees are high, and the hike is 10%. Every year, the tuition fees are increased. The education cost will be roughly 24 lakhs, including tuition fees, hostel, and mess. There are scholarships available, such as the Aspire Scholarship, which is a private scholarship in which you get a 100% scholarship, and it is the same for the 100% scholarship that is UNIQLO.

Campus Life :

The name of the annual fest is Odyssey in January, and the name of the technical fest is ESYA in September. The library has all the books, from academics to computer science books to novels and fiction. Every classrooms has a projector a white board and a green boards with chairs. Every sport is provided in the college, but the size is small, comparable to other colleges. So many social clubs exist, including Foobar, enacts, Cyfuse, and many more.

Hostel Facilities :

The hostel room is two students in a room with two different beds and two study tables. The quality of food provided in the hostel mess is great. We just have to go to the Student Affairs office, get a form from there and fill and submit it to them, then we will get to the hostel.

Admission :

The courses are offered to the students who took the JEE Mains exam, or there is also an admission process for commerce students through 12th percentage and from UCEED. The application form for the college can be obtained from JAC counselling. The application fee is 1200 for the counseling, and after you got the college, you have to give 96000 to the college to freeze your seat, then you pay the semester fee of 96000 less as you had already given that amount. The reservations are available for EWS/OBC/SC/ST. The JEE Mains exam is difficult as more than 12lakh students took the JEE Mains Exam, and very few got a good government college seat.

Faculty :

The faculty-to-student ratio is about 25-30:1, and the learning experience is great because there are also Teaching assistants who help us with the topics. The faculties are MITian IITians, PhDs, and also foreign professors, so the credentials of the faculty are great, and the approach to teaching is good. We can interact with the faculty at the end of every lecture or the faculty makes a meetup time of about 1 hour 2 times a week in which students can come to their office and discuss with them.
